Experience the warm, inviting charm of Hot Plate, a beloved local diner nestled in the heart of Minneapolis. Surrounded by nostalgic art-covered walls and eclectic décor, this cozy eatery serves as a comforting escape where lively conversations blend with the clinking of coffee cups. Whether catching up with friends or savoring solo moments over classic American comfort food, Hot Plate offers an authentic taste of community spirit wrapped in casual, homey vibes. Feel the friendly buzz, the soft daylight streaming through windows, and the simple joy of good food in a place where every chair seems to welcome you like an old friend. The nearest airport is Minneapolis–Saint Paul International Airport (MSP), located just 20 minutes from downtown Minneapolis by car or public transit.
